Lines `5x + 12y - 10 = 0` and `5x - 12y - 40 = 0` touch a circle C1 of diameter 6. If the center of C1, lies in the first quadrant, find the equation of the circle C2, which is concentric with C1, and cuts intercept of length 8 on these lines
